  • Remove Weight
    Get rid of unnecessary weight by cleaning out the trunk. You are losing one mile off fuel efficiency for every 200-pound weight.
  • Use the Air Conditioner Efficiently
    The AC can drain engine power, thus fuel, heavily. Try to park in the shade to reduce indoor heat so that the AC won’t need much work to cool down the car.
  • Think Twice on Premium Fuel
    Unless required by the manufacturer, you don’t really need premium fuel for your car. Fill up the tank with regular gas instead to save costs.
  • Keep Tires Inflated
    Take note of the manufacturer’s recommended tire pressure. Experts believe that keeping four to five psi below the required pressure increases fuel consumption by up to ten percent.
